Cleveland, WI and Mosinee, WI have a very similar cost of living, with only a 0.7% difference in their overall index. Cleveland scores 76 while Mosinee scores 76 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Cleveland is $921/month compared to $1,056/month in Mosinee — a 13%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Cleveland has cheaper rent, Mosinee actually has lower median home values ($150,000 vs $192,500).

Median household income in Cleveland is $75,000 compared to $71,314 in Mosinee (+5.2%). Cleveland off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Cleveland spend roughly 14.7% of their income on rent, less than the 17.8% in Mosinee.
